Bolivarian Revolution has battled for sovereignty and peace


“After meeting three years of the physical disappearance of the leader of the Bolivarian Revolution, Hugo Chavez, this political process has led the battle to keep the peace, sovereignty, dignity and stability of the Homeland”, said on Tuesday the President of the Republic, Nicolas Maduro.
“It’s been three years of struggle for sovereignty, for independence, for peace, for dignity. And such a good fight, Commander Hugo Chavez! You had prepared us, and we have battled, and (this) is just the beginning of many battles to consolidate this Revolution, this Republic, this free Homeland, this sovereign Homeland”, said the head of state on a broadcast by Venezolana de Television.
By participating in the commemorative acts in honor of Hugo Chavez, which were performed at the Mountain headquarters, in the 23 de Enero parish in Caracas, the National President said that these three years have been complex.
As a reflection, President Maduro also recalled the attacks that his Government has received. He referred to the violent events during the “guarimbas” (street riot barricades of 2014) which submitted to a situation of instability and kidnapping to families in the major cities of the country ruled by right-wing parties.
He further explained that, the imperial forces were prepared for every action, because they knew about the severity of the illness of Commander Chavez and, therefore, after his disappearance they carried out destabilizing plans.
